diff options
author | Robert Schwebel <r.schwebel@pengutronix.de> | 2009-06-09 12:43:24 +0000 |
---|---|---|
committer | Robert Schwebel <r.schwebel@pengutronix.de> | 2009-06-09 12:43:24 +0000 |
commit | aff8230c403dd4f3d25e19c4e68c8339d2a44082 (patch) | |
tree | c685e7f87c3251a3002b9b21426833210c53b66a /rules | |
parent | 8c63bbe27a621a4f17ad02afffaa407633cb5f21 (diff) | |
download | ptxdist-aff8230c403dd4f3d25e19c4e68c8339d2a44082.tar.gz ptxdist-aff8230c403dd4f3d25e19c4e68c8339d2a44082.tar.xz |
dropbear: add more dependencies, change zlib logic
Add more dependencies for dropbear; while being there, change the menu
logic of zlib support.
Signed-off-by: Robert Schwebel <r.schwebel@pengutronix.de>
git-svn-id: https://svn.pengutronix.de/svn/ptxdist/trunks/ptxdist-trunk@10661 33e552b5-05e3-0310-8538-816dae2090ed
Diffstat (limited to 'rules')
-rw-r--r-- | rules/dropbear.in | 8 | ||||
-rw-r--r-- | rules/dropbear.make | 4 |
2 files changed, 8 insertions, 4 deletions
diff --git a/rules/dropbear.in b/rules/dropbear.in index f7e99a57f..2aa8d0021 100644 --- a/rules/dropbear.in +++ b/rules/dropbear.in @@ -1,9 +1,11 @@ ## SECTION=networking menuconfig DROPBEAR tristate - prompt "dropbear ssh-server " + prompt "dropbear " select ZLIB select LIBC_UTIL + select LIBC_CRYPT + select INITMETHOD help dropbear is a SSH 2 server and client designed to be small enough to be used in small memory @@ -18,9 +20,9 @@ menuconfig DROPBEAR if DROPBEAR -config DROPBEAR_DIS_ZLIB +config DROPBEAR_ZLIB bool - prompt "Don't include zlib support" + prompt "zlib support" help Disable compresion in Dropbear by dropping use of zlib. diff --git a/rules/dropbear.make b/rules/dropbear.make index f7c1c0c80..870102179 100644 --- a/rules/dropbear.make +++ b/rules/dropbear.make @@ -48,7 +48,9 @@ DROPBEAR_AUTOCONF := \ $(CROSS_AUTOCONF_USR) \ --disable-nls -ifdef PTXCONF_DROPBEAR_DIS_ZLIB +ifdef PTXCONF_DROPBEAR_ZLIB +DROPBEAR_AUTOCONF += --enable-zlib +else DROPBEAR_AUTOCONF += --disable-zlib endif |